Plasma biomarkers for distinguishing etiological subtypes of thoracic aortic aneurysm disease
BACKGROUND: Thoracic aortic aneurysms (TAAs) develop through an asymptomatic process resulting in gross dilatation that progresses to rupture if left undetected and untreated.
